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 4972 777440779
43 0843746 74614204924
43 0843746 74614204924
94440 16 6151830804 9691 40942976836
All about undefined
Interested in learning more?
43 0843746 74614204924
94440 16 6151830804 9691 40942976836
See more
570399 488
353569821 6391 43
See more
024619674 350
4285756333 5264 2809
See more